Frequently Asked Questions

What is a wideband oxygen sensor?

A wideband oxygen sensor gauges the air-fuel ratio in an engine, providing more precise data compared to traditional sensors.

How do I know if a wideband sensor is compatible with my vehicle?

Check the sensor’s specifications, including connector type and compatibility with your engine management system.

Why is sensor technology important?

Advanced sensor technology can significantly enhance response times and accuracy, which are crucial for performance tuning and emissions management.
